We often get requests to provide the difficulty ratings of the BDR. We do not officially rate roads or routes because the difficulty can change from day to day depending on weather, changes in road conditions, and road damage caused by a variety of forces including wind, storms, …ROUTE UPDATES. Routes are chosen to balance longevity, beauty, adventure, and gas stations, but things can change in the backcountry. Here we post updates, closures, route changes and other route specific information everyone planning to ride a BDR should know. To report any route updates, changes or closures, please fill out this form.

Twelfth in the series of cross state routes developed by BDR for dual-sport and adventure motorcycle travel, this 750-mile ride through scenic and diverse terrain starts in the high desert landscapes of South Eastern Oregon, and explores its way North, through the dense forests, rugged mountains, and volcanic peaks of the Northern Cascade Range. The Arizona Backcountry Discovery Route (AZBDR) is a 750-mile scenic ride across the state of Arizona, beginning at the Mexico border and finishing at the Utah border.
